Method 1: Standardize your titles The simplest way to organize a novel-sized writing project (or any big project) is to create a new notebook dedicated to that project. Move all the notes for your project into that notebook, and just search for the notes you need. Easy-peasy.

How to Meet a Deadline – Time Management Training From ~ Despite all your hard work and forethought, you might still miss a deadline. If this happens, keep calm and make every effort to limit the damage. Keep your stakeholders informed of progress throughout your work, highlighting any issues that delay you, and show that you are putting your contingency plans into action.
